Physics is a natural science requiring a high level of mathematicalknowledge."Ordinary high school physics curriculum standard" formulatedby Ministry of Education demonstrates "through the process of learningphysical concepts and rules, students should understand the study method ofphysics and the roles of physics experiments, the physical model andmathematical tool in the development of physics." At the same time, onemajor characteristic of physical science is "mathematics is the language andthe tool of learning physics." Students can not solve difficult physicsproblems if they are not able to use the tool. The course of physicsproblem-solving process itself is the use of physical principles andmathematical algorithm to solve the problem.Due to the influence of subject-specific teaching, students have formed arelatively fixed physics thinking in the process of physics learning, so in theprocess of solving physics problems, mathematics can not gush automaticallyin the brain of the students, which requires the teacher to remind andstrengthen in the form of instances. Various methods, such as extremaltrigonometric function and the variation of various relations, equation of thestraight line and circle permutation and combination of knowledge, and thesummation series, derivative and limit etc, are often used in the process ofsolving physical problems, which requires teachers to select some typicalexamples of infiltration, and let the students develop the habit of solvingphysics problems using mathematical method.The main purpose of this paper is to find out the related degree betweenphysics and mathematics and their influence degree. For students in seniorhigh school, in the transition and the beginning of the stage, which physicallearning difficulties are caused because of poor mathematical knowledge?What should teachers pay attention to at this stage of teaching? How toimprove? Based on solving these problems, mathematical knowledge and mathematical methods in physics learning in senior high school are concluded;some representative problems are selected; whether students have graspedsome common mathematical methods in physics learning in senior highschool is surveyed; two subjects score correlations are investigated betweentwo similar classes. In order to ensure the universality and comprehensivedata source, the writer chooses10classes in grade one of Inner MongoliaBayannaoer No.1middle school, a total of561people;11classes in gradetwo, a total of685people,and compares maths and physics marks from thetwo top classes in grade two.The study lasts a semester,from2012September to2013January.Through the research and practice of ability of using mathematicalknowledge to solve the physical problem, the students’ understanding ofmathematics knowledge and methods to solve the problems of high schoolphysics are what teachers have expected. But the students’ understanding isnot directly proportional to their mathematics knowledge application level.After research, the writer carefully prepares a test which can fully reflect theapplication of mathematics in physics, further consolidates practice effect,and puts forward some measures on how to strengthen applications ofmathematics knowledge and mathematics thought in physics through theresearch and practice.
